Cases to date: 602
Active infections: 14
Deaths: five (two in Huntsville, one in Muskoka Lakes, one in Bracebridge, one in Gravenhurst)
Resolved cases: 583
Muskoka cases to date with confirmed or suspected variants of concern:
Alpha (B.1.1.7): 185
Beta (B.1.351): one
Gamma (P.1): five
Delta (B.1.617): 108
Screened positive for a mutation of interest: 27

Cases to date by municipality:
- Huntsville: 160 (two active, 156 resolved, two deceased)
- Lake of Bays: 37 (one active, 36 resolved)
- Muskoka Lakes: 128 (127 resolved, one deceased)
- Bracebridge: 126 (six active, 119 resolved, one deceased)
- Gravenhurst: 115 (three active, 111 resolved, one deceased)
- Georgian Bay: 36 (two active, 34 resolved)
Immunizations
Muskoka residents age 12 and older only
- First dose: 51,501 (85.6 per cent)
- Second dose: 49,062 (81.6 per cent)
Simcoe Muskoka residents, total population (including ages 12 and under, who are not currently eligible for the vaccine)
- First dose: 458,116 (75.8 per cent)
- Second dose: 434,401 (71.9 per cent)
